Resumo: | Mussels are bivalve mollusks that developed a filtrating system enabling them to uptake nutrients from water. This is a not selective mechanism, so mussels microbiological analysis shows up the aquatic environment quality. Therefore, the present work aimed to isolate and identify bacterial microbiota from bivalve mollusks incrustated into the rocky coast of Arquip?lago de Santana, Maca?, RJ. The antimicrobial resistance pattern of prevalent microorganisms isolated was also analyzed. The surrounding water microbiological quality was also evaluated in order to detect contamination source from fishing and subaquatic activities in the studied region. From the bacteriological analysis it was obtained a total of 51 isolates of Vibrio spp., being V. damsela (n=15) the prevalent specie, followed by V. harveyi (n=13) and V. alginolyticus (n=07). It was also obtained a total of 20 isolates of Enterobacteriaceae species, being Escherichia coli (n=06) the prevalent one, followed by Proteus vulgaris (n=04). Vibrio spp. isolates presented 100% of sensitivity to tested antimicrobials, except for ampicillin with no detected sensitivity corroborating to literature. For enterobacteria, it was detected a high percentile of sensitivity to all testes antimicrobials. In the six samples of ocean water analyzed it was not possible to detect total or fecal coliforms. The low percentile of isolated microorganisms from mussels at Arquip?lago de Santana can be justified for its location at the open sea, far away from the coast and influenced by sea currents, in a environment not yet altered by human action. |
